With every recipe under 30 minutes, Speedy Weeknight Meals is the go-to book for quick, easy and delicious dinners every time. Chapters cover Fast and Flavourful, Quick Comforts, Family Favourites, Speedy One Pan, Low Calorie, Few Ingredients and Sweet Treats.

Jon's recipes span classic crowd-pleasers like Chilli Con Carne to fresh flavours like Bang Bang Chicken. While most of the recipes are new, Jon includes a handful of his biggest fan-favourites from his socials @jonwatts88. With over a million followers across his channels, Jon's cooking and his personal story is inspiring a fast-growing audience to make delicious cooked-from-scratch meals.

  • About the Author

    Jon Watts first learned to cook in prison where he was admitted, aged 18, for six and a half years.

    Jon says: As the heavy steel door slammed behind me for the first time, I realised I had to make serious changes if I wanted to have any chance of success in my life. The most likely scenario that was facing me was that I would fall into the vicious cycle of reoffending. I was determined from day one that I would not add to the statistics.

    He set about changing his story and, with cooking as his specialism, became the first person in custody to complete the bronze, silver and gold. He went on to work for Jamie Oliver for five years before branching out on his own to share his story and recipes online @Jonwatts88. His ambition has seen him amass an audience of over one million and cook live on prime time tv.

    Jon is passionate about supporting young people to make good choices and does motivational speaking and runs an apprenticeship scheme with young offenders.
